ا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

هل يمكن الجمع بين vlookup و or


triste

الردود الموصى بها

الأخوة الكرام :

لدى ورقة عمل ، العمود الأول يحتوى على أرقام مرجعية للعناصر المجودة بالعمود الثانى بشكل متناظر

و لكن ، يمكن أن يكون هناك أكثر من رقم مرجعى للعنصر الواحد ، بمعنى أن نفس العنصر لو تكرر أكثر من مرة بالعمود الثانى ، يمكن أن يوجد رقم مرجعى مختلف له فى العمود الأول ( بحد أقصى رقمين مرجعيين للعنصر الواحد)

و ما أريده ، هو استخدام دالة vlookup مع دالة or

بحيث يقوم الإكسيل بجمع القيم الموجودة بالعمود الثالث ، قرين العمود الأول و الثانى

كما لو كنت أقول :

+vlookup(1 or 3 ; b3:b5 ; c3:c5)

بمعنى لو كان الرقم المرجعى بالعمود

لb

هو

1

أو

3

اجمع القيم الموجودة

فى العمود c

رابط هذا التعليق
شارك

راااااااااااااااااااااااااااااااااااااااااااااااااااااااااااائع

بل و أكثر من رااااااااااااااااااائع بالفعل ، أخى / تامر عمر .. أنت عبقرى فعلاً

هذا ما كنت فى أمس الحاجة إليه بالفعل ، بارك الله فيك و جزاك عنى كل خير إن شاء الله.

فقط أرجو منك أن تشرح لى فكرة المعادلة التى وضعتها و حللت من خلالها المشكلة ، ، و لماذا و كيف تم من خلالها حل المشكلة ، خاصةً أننى لا أستخدم countif عادةً و لم أستطع أن أفهم كيف تحقق ما أحتاجه من خلال المزج بينها و بين sumif.

مرة أخرى لا أعرف كيف أشكرك ، و لا تعلم أنت كم ساعدتنى و أسديت لى معروفاً كبيراً جدً ، بهذا الحل . أشكرك شكراً جزيلاً.

و فى إنتظار شرحك الكريم .

رابط هذا التعليق
شارك

الاخ triste

تحياتى لك

اخى العزيز

محرك الصيغة يكمن فى الجزء الاول من الشرط

=IF(COUNTIF($A$2:A2;A2)=1;SUMIF($A$2:$A$9;A2;$C$2:$C$9);"")
وهو (COUNTIF) يتم الجمع بأستخدام (SUMIF) كالمعتاد ولكننا نريد ان يتم الجمع فى اول ظهور الحدث (محمد) مثلا وهنا يأتى دور الشرط الذى يسمح بالجمع فقط اذا كان محمد هو اول اسم ل (محمد) وليس الثانى او لثالث بالنسبة للعمود (D) ففى كل خلية سطر منه تم تثبيت بداية عد الحدث (محمد) ب ($A$2) وانتهى بهذا السطر (A2) فيكون عدد مرات تكرار الحدث 1 وهنا يتحقق الشرط ويتم الجمع عن طريق (SUMIF) لكل تكرارت الحدث (محمد) اما فى السطر الخامس المحتوى على الحدث الثانى من (محمد) لننظر الى الشرط الموجود فية سنجد الاتى
COUNTIF($A$2:A5;A5)

سنجد انه يقوم بعد الحدث (محمد) من البداية ($A$2) الى هذا السطر (A5)

فيكون ناتج (COUNTIF) هو 2 فلا تقوم دالة (IF) بنتفيذ الجمع عن طريق (SUMIF)

اتمنى ان اكون استطعت التوضيح

تحياتى

رابط هذا التعليق
شارك

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information